Job Description

AECOM is seeking an experienced and motivated full-time Ecological Risk Assessor to become an integrated member of AECOM’s risk assessment and remediation practices. The location of this position is flexible and may be either in-office or remote.

In this role, your responsibilities will include:

  • Supporting a wide range of projects for private and government clients throughout the U.S. (and internationally).
  • Performing and reviewing ecological risk assessments in accordance with regulatory guidance and project-specific work plans.
  • Developing Risk Assessment Work Plans and contributing to Sampling and Analysis Plans/Quality Assurance Project Plans.
  • Successfully coordinating with internal project teams, including delegating to junior staff.
  • Preparing technical deliverables; including writing reports and performing/reviewing risk assessment calculations.
  • Contributing to proposals and business development, including developing scopes of work and cost estimates for ecological risk assessment.
  • Mentoring/developing more junior staff.
  • Maintaining knowledge of federal and state regulations/guidance documents for conducting risk assessments.
  • Maintaining work quality, quantity, and efficiency at or above company standards.
  • Must be willing to perform occasional field work, as needed.

 

Qualifications

Minimum Qualifications:

  • BA/BS degree in Ecotoxicology, Ecology, Zoology, Environmental Science/Studies, Chemistry, Toxicology, Biology or other related area AND 6+ years of experience performing ecological risk assessments in an environmental consulting setting, or demonstrated equivalence of education and experience.   
  • Due to the nature of work, US Citizenship is required.
  • Valid Driver’s License and as a condition of employment must be able to pass AECOM’s Motor Vehicle Records review and background check.  

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Master’s or PhD degree in Ecotoxicology, Ecology, Zoology, Environmental Science/Studies, Chemistry, Toxicology, Biology, Zoology, or other related area.
  • Applied knowledge of USEPA guidance for conducting ecological risk assessment.
  • Excellent technical writing and communication skills.
  • Experience conducting food web/bioaccumulation assessments.
  • Experience performing data analysis and applied statistics.
  • Excellent technical writing and communication skills.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Excel and Word.
  • Experience evaluating PFAS, PCBs, and lead.
  • CERCLA experience with Remedial Investigations, Feasibility Studies, and ROD development.
  • Site investigation and field sampling and wildlife assessment experience.
  • Experience working on Navy or Department of Defense.
  • Experience dealing with the Hawaii Department of Health and EPA Region 9
  • Experience working with projects in Hawaii, Guam and other Pacific Islands
  • Preferred work location Hawaii.
  • Experience performing wildlife assessments.
